Output 5dd79235c51afc4466ae6cc018d64e3fc704b5e281e63806e02d68cf3a3d9bcb:0

value
20476615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ec3a1019070d8edad196e2e4af24f1c3a9a7a3 OP_EQUAL
address
3EuJDVb648riMj1pbQDzsXpHRn5qjrbVqx
transaction
5dd79235c51afc4466ae6cc018d64e3fc704b5e281e63806e02d68cf3a3d9bcb
spent
true